I have a small Installer script called logic.st:
Installer cache install: 'AlgebraicDataType'; install: 'Unification'; install: 'Zippers' and I pass that in as the startup script when I start up my Squeak (whether a pre-4.3 or a 4.3 (yay!)), I see the usual progress bar. It says "Compiling AlgebraicDataType-fbs.nn" and then "Installing AlgebraicDataType-fbs.nn", as expected. And then it says the same thing again, talking about installing and compiling AlgebraicDataType instead of Unification, and then again when loading Zippers. The packages all load correctly: it's just the progress morph giving a misleading status message. Has anyone else seen this? frank |

Has anyone else seen this? Yes, AlgebraicDataType will be installed three times, Unification twice. This is because #install: is implemented as #addPackage:, then #install. Since the Installer subinstance is kept between #install sends, therefore the installations will repeat. The solution is to use #addPackage: and #install directly: Installer cache addPackage: 'AlgebraicDataType'; addPackage: 'Unification'; addPackage: 'Zippers'; install or using a collection: Installer cache install: #('AlgebraicDataType' 'Unification' 'Zippers') Levente > > frank > > |
